Discussione chiusa
Visualizzazione dei risultati da 1 a 7 su 7

inversione in una data giorno e mese

  1. #1
    trump61 non  in linea Scolaretto
    Ciao, sono di nuovo qui, mi sono imbattuto in una situazione alquanto
    bizarra almeno per me, ora spero di riuscire questa volta a
    spiegarmi, lavorando sul file per il quale ho chiesto precedentemente
    aiuto mi ritrovo ad avere su una colonna una data precedentemente
    inserita, su un' altra colonna un data ricavata con la funzione OGGI()
    le importo in due textBox posizionate su una userform, poi tramite il
    codice
    suggeritomi cliccando su un commandbutton vado a mettere la data
    ricavata dalla funzione OGGI() riportata in una textbox, al posto di
    quella inserita precedentemente ma meraviglia la data copiata nella
    cella mi appare con il valore dei giorni al posto di quella dei mesi
    cioe' 1011/2009 mi diventa 11/10/2009, ho provato a verdere se dipende
    dalle propriet della textbox ma non mi sembra, secondo voi cosa
    successo?
    Grazie

  2. #2
    L'avatar di Elimar
    Elimar non  in linea Scribacchino
    Ciao cosa succeda di preciso non l'ho mai capito bene neanch'io, e spero che qualcuno ti dia la risposta in modo da poter colmare questa mia lacuna.

    Per quanto riguarda la gesione della data solitamente utilizzo questo codice per ovviare al problema:

    CDate(Left("1011/2009", 2) & "/" & Mid("1011/2009", 3, 2) & Right("1011/2009", 5))
    
    Mi spiace di non poterti essere di maggior aiuto.
    ℹ️ Leggi di pi su Elimar ...

  3. #3
    L'avatar di yronium
    yronium non  in linea Scribacchino
    Parliamo di Excel? La sfera di cristallo dal meccanico.

    Quote Originariamente inviato da trump61 Visualizza il messaggio
    secondo voi cosa
    successo?
    Hai semplicemente fatto confusione con il formato delle date. Il pc spesso gestisce le date secondo il formato americano mm/dd/yyyy, mentre a noi italiani piace il formato italiano gg/mm/aaaa. Devi verificare il formato della cella e il formato dei dati della textbox, e sincronizzare il tutto gestendo il formato della data con la funzione Format(). Trovi maggiori dettagli sulla Guida.

    Spero sia utile. Ciao.


    PS: non necessario che vai a capo quando scrivi un messaggio. Tu scrivi tutto in linea, e quando clicchi su Invia le righe del messaggio vengono sistemate automaticamente alla larghezza opportuna.
    ℹ️ Leggi di pi su yronium ...

  4. #4
    trump61 non  in linea Scolaretto
    Worksheets("Foglio2").Range(TextBox10.Value).Offse t(0, 6).Value = Format(TextBox11.Value, "dd/mm/yyyy")

    Ho provato, ma purtroppo non funziona neanche cos, poi preso dalla pazzia ho sostituito "dd/mm/yyyy" con "gg/mm/aaaa" risultato sulla cella dove dovrebbe sostituire la data compare gg/11/aaaa, cio il mese era al posto giusto, cosi ho sostituito gg con 02 e nella cella compare 02/11/aaaa, poi ho provato sbagliando "dd/mm" & "yyyy" nella cella compare 02/112009 perch ho scordato lo slash a questo punto mi sono detto EVVAI RISOLTO per farla breve ho provato a conastenare anche lo slash nella cella compare 11/02/2009 ARGHHH!!!!!!!!!!!! CI RISIAMO, il problema sembrerebbe il secondo separatore ma non son poi riuscito a risolvere.

  5. #5
    trump61 non  in linea Scolaretto
    Sono di nuovo qui,
    Worksheets("Foglio2").Range(TextBox10.Value).Offse t(0, 6).Value = CDate(TextBox11.Value)
    Cos funziona se interesa a qualcuno.
    Ciao

  6. #6
    Lorenz non  in linea Novello
    come hai definito la "t".
    ho il tuo stesso problema

    grazie

  7. #7
    Lorenz ... questo un thread del 2009 e quindi troppo vecchio per continuare a rispondere.

    Apri un nuovo thread, eventualmente fai riferimento con un link a questo.

    A parte il fatto che la tua domanda non affatto chiara.
    ℹ️ Leggi di pi su AntonioG ...

Discussione chiusa

Potrebbero interessarti anche ...

  1. Articolo: Scelta data da Calendario con 3 Combo(Anno, Mese e Giorno)
    Da @Alex nel forum Microsoft Access
    Risposte: 0
    Ultimo Post: 09-04-2015, 17:43
  2. Inversione mese/giorno durante copia matrice su foglio
    Da genespos nel forum Microsoft Excel
    Risposte: 14
    Ultimo Post: 12-03-2014, 12:48
  3. Risposte: 24
    Ultimo Post: 07-04-2012, 19:43
  4. Filtro su data,inverte giorno e mese
    Da RINCOALISA nel forum Microsoft Word
    Risposte: 13
    Ultimo Post: 14-09-2007, 16:15
  5. Risposte: 4
    Ultimo Post: 10-10-2006, 17:46